Feng Shui Tips for Apartments and Condos Print E-mail

Bringing balance into your space


We all want a balanced space, but what do you do if
your space is not fully under your influence of control.
Or is it?

Here are some guidelines for those of you with Apartments
and Condos
as well as some general guidelines to be aware
of in working with or choosing your next residence

1. Do not choose an apartment that the elevator opens
facing your front door.
This sets up a what is called a
“poison arrow” or “shar chi” and will bring confusing,
unpredictable or unstable energy to your home leaving you
feeling much of the time as if you are under attack.

2. Go for open space. Choose a home that when you open
the front door it is into the whole room versus tiny hallways
and closets or narrow walls. A lot of tiny rooms divide the
family. Look for large gathering areas where the family can
be united.

3. Brighten up narrow corridors with lighting and
bright artwork or color on walls.

4. Look for the structural beams above you. It is best
not to have to many floors above you due to all the large
beams pressing down on your energy. Penthouses, however,
are not optimum either due to being to many floors from
the earth, denying you the precious energy of the earth. To
enjoy good Feng Shui you need to have a combination
of heaven, earth and human energy.

5. Avoid any buildings that have swimming pools on
the roof.
This is known as ”water on the mountain” and
may bring misfortune.

6. Avoid any buildings with visible stilts or columns
supporting it.
You want the space to be firmly rooted in
the soil with a strong foundation.

7. Be sure there are not visible roads on both front and
rear of the house.
The rear of the building should have
land mass or other buildings that are higher representing “A
mountain at your back”. Same principle applies with land or
buildings on the sides when standing looking out of your
main entrance to any space the land on left should be
higher than the right which represents the all powerful
Dragon which is keeping you healthy wealthy and wise.

8. Your home represents your life. Even within
apartments and condos, the proper placement of furniture
and the absence of clutter is highly important for a balanced
life.
